United Partners with Jetstar for Adelaide Route
Locales: AUSTRALIA, UNITED STATES

A Strategic Partnership with Jetstar
Key to making this new route viable is United's partnership with Jetstar, a low-cost Australian carrier. This collaboration isn't simply about code-sharing. It suggests a carefully constructed network that allows United to leverage Jetstar's existing domestic network within Australia. Passengers arriving in Adelaide on United flights will likely find seamless connections to other Australian destinations via Jetstar, providing a broader reach and increased travel flexibility. This is a growing trend in the airline industry, where partnerships allow carriers to extend their reach without the massive investment of establishing entirely new routes and infrastructure.
Adelaide: An Underrated Gem
For years, Adelaide has been somewhat overlooked by international tourists, often overshadowed by the more prominent cities of Sydney and Melbourne. However, South Australia is gaining recognition as a premier destination for its world-class wine regions, notably the Barossa Valley and McLaren Vale. The state also boasts stunning natural beauty, from the rugged Flinders Ranges to pristine beaches, and a vibrant arts and culture scene centered around festivals like WOMADelaide.
The influx of North American travelers facilitated by United's new route is expected to significantly boost the South Australian tourism industry. Tourism officials anticipate a surge in visitors eager to explore the region's offerings, leading to increased revenue for local businesses, hotels, and tour operators. The South Australian Tourism Commission has been actively working to promote the state internationally, and this new airline route provides a crucial platform for reaching a key demographic - affluent North American travelers seeking authentic and unique experiences.
Competitive Pressures and Trans-Pacific Travel
The introduction of this route also intensifies competition within the already crowded trans-Pacific market. While Qantas remains the dominant player, airlines like Delta and American Airlines also offer significant service to Australia. United's move demonstrates a clear ambition to capture a larger share of this lucrative market. The airline will be hoping to attract passengers with its competitive pricing, superior customer service (a key differentiator in the industry), and the convenience of direct access to Adelaide.
Booking and Future Expectations
Tickets for the United Airlines flights to Adelaide are expected to become available later in 2024, giving travelers ample time to plan their trips. Passengers can anticipate a range of fare options and cabin classes, allowing them to tailor their travel experience to their budget and preferences. The timing of the launch in October 2025 aligns with the beginning of the Australian summer, an ideal time to visit the region.
Looking ahead, analysts predict that the success of this route could pave the way for further expansion of United's presence in Australia. The airline may consider adding additional flights to Adelaide or exploring new routes to other regional destinations. This move signals a long-term commitment to the Australian market and a growing recognition of the region's potential as a major travel destination.
